There are a number of other things that you should be thinking about when you're looking to buy a used family car. You should be checking the history of the car, to see if it has had any major repairs or replacements and what mileage the car has done in relation to the age of it. It could have been used by a sales rep to tour the country - as many have a large space to store many different things - or it may have been used by a single parent as a commuter to use around the local town and take the children to school.
If you have decided that purchasing your used vehicle is going to be a car and you are not overly bothered about the interior size of your car, then you should go for the choice of buying a smaller car. By purchasing a smaller car, it will mean that your fuel consumption per mile will be lower and your insurance group will be at a lower price too.
Making sure that the car has been looked after and cared about in the past should be of importance to you, and you should check the history of the car to make sure of this. You want to make sure that if there has been any major changes or modifications to the car that they are ok and it hasnt been in a major collision or have any nasty surprises that could come about after you have purchased it.
